What are the two things gargoyles are used for?

Decoration - and to direct rainwater away from the building. They're usually hollow - or have a tube exiting the mouth. This stops rainwater running down the side of the building - preventing erosion.

What is Direct Addressing in computer systems architecture?

Direct Addressing in computer systems architecture is when the number in the address field of the instruction is the actual memory address to be accessed.
